This latest generation pansy bears an abundance of medium-sized orange flowers with black spots. They are carried by short stems, widely open towards the sky. The plants are compact, early-flowering, and perfectly uniform. They are easy to grow in humus-rich moist soil, in a sunny or partially shaded position.

Description

Viola Inspire Orange Blotch is undoubtedly one of the best hybrid pansies in its category, ideal for brightening up window boxes and flower beds from the end of winter. It produces an abundance of flowers in a bright and clear orange, highlighted by almost black macules. They are carried by short but sturdy stems, which allow the corollas to bloom widely towards the sky. The plants are compact, early-flowering, and perfectly uniform. This variety regrows well in spring and does not bolt with the first heat, ensuring a long flowering period. It is an easy-to-grow biennial plant in humus-rich moist soil.

 

Garden pansies, sometimes called giant Swiss pansies, are hybrids grouped under Viola x wittrockiana. They belong to the Violaceae family and are most often grown as annuals or biennials, although they are theoretically short-lived perennials. This variety is a ramified plant that quickly forms compact clumps with a slightly spreading habit, 15cm (6in) in height and 20cm (8in) in width. It blooms early, from the end of winter to the end of spring, or from the end of spring to the end of summer. It bears fully open medium-sized flowers, 6cm (2in) wide, adorned with a beautiful orange colour. Black macules form a four-leaf clover at the base of the petals, around a tiny bright yellow and white centre. The medium green leaves are elliptical and widely crenate.

Pansies are wonderful in the garden, but they also work beautifully in a pot on a windowsill to be enjoyed up close. They look perfect alongside primroses, wallflowers, grape hyacinths, and daisies. They even go well with grasses like Japanese sedge for a contemporary effect. Play with the colours of pansies, in shades of blue, or in contrast with white or warm colours, and you will achieve different atmospheres.

Pansy petals are edible, and their colours will bring a touch of originality to salads and pastries. For this use, think of growing them as you would grow your vegetables, in the most natural way possible.

Planting and care

Pansies thrive in humus-rich, neutral to acidic, moist and fertile soil. A quality horticultural compost will be very suitable. They appreciate a sunny or semi-shaded exposure. They are fast-growing and produce an abundance of blooms, making them hungry plants. They need to be fed with a liquid plant food for containers once or twice a week during the growth period. Water regularly but without excess. Regularly remove faded flowers to encourage new blooms.
